MS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2024 in Review

1,866 of the 6,964 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Morgan Stanley (MS) for Q3 2024, worth a combined $141B — up 7.6% from $131B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 175 funds opened new MS positions and 108 closed out — a net gain of 67 holders — while 761 added to existing stakes and 658 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ital Research Global Investors, adding an estimated $644M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$866M.
